Natural enemies deployment in patchy environments for augmentative biological control

Highlights:

• The influence of space on the efficacy of augmentative biological control is studied.

• A two-patch predator–prey model with discrete periodic predator releases is proposed.

• The spatio-temporal pattern of biocontrol agents introductions drives their efficacy.

• The threshold release rate for pest eradication increases with the release period.

• Frequent and small predator releases yield more effective pest suppression.
